Correct.
You can do a VM full backup with the basic client, without TSM/VE.
For incremental forever you need the VE license.

>> Tom,
>>
>> This is a known issue and we are working on it. See APAR IT04554. The 
>> local fix suggests:
>>
>> 1 - Run custom install of the 7.1.1.0 TSM for Virtual Environments 
>> install suite from PPA, Choose to only install the TSM for Virtual 
>> Environments enablement file.
>>
>> As an alternative, you can uninstall the product completely and then 
>> install 7.1.1.
>>
>> Let me know if this resolves the issue.
